Output db6de6497123a5899e8a25288e94c2dab3f224eb33d5ad468d18479809578966:4

value
31935702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dfd4fd1835fed90561e43a0d0381e1f01f34be4 OP_EQUAL
address
MKPL9pZJAqqhDqEbZ1ckapkrZLJ3A8NDCt
transaction
db6de6497123a5899e8a25288e94c2dab3f224eb33d5ad468d18479809578966
spent
true